liniał

Polish

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): /ˈli.ɲaw/
  • (file)
  • Rhymes: -iɲaw
  • Syllabification: li‧niał

Etymology 1

Borrowed from German Lineal.

Noun

liniał m inan

  1. ruler (measuring or drawing device)
    Synonym: lineał
